Output 15561a8ee24032fa01ba515aca85a5106c200fa36f122187f34a3607936e3f4a:2

value
27490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b26848645a7aede188636205a4b948ff702f3df OP_EQUAL
address
3JkaRfsHgeDf4XMADEvTGduEA6mivzCyZ5
transaction
15561a8ee24032fa01ba515aca85a5106c200fa36f122187f34a3607936e3f4a
spent
true